graesslin added a comment.


  In D17304#370672 <https://phabricator.kde.org/D17304#370672>, @apol wrote:
  
  > Wouldn't this make more sense as a KConfig setting to override through kiosk?
  
  
  The same cannot be achieved with kiosk as:
  
  - there is no way to globally disable kglobalaccel
  - vt switching cannot be disabled
  - screenedges are cumbersome, e.g. need to be configured on the effect basis
  - mouse shortcuts cannot be disabled through kconfig
  - touch gestures cannot be disabled through kconfig
